Understanding CNC Cutting Tools


Computer-controlled machining depends on tools that can remove material with accuracy while maintaining exact dimensions. These tools are used for milling, drilling, threading, boring, turning and finishing operations across industries such as automotive, aerospace, tooling, fabrication and engineering sectors. A quality cutting tool must withstand heat, friction, vibration and repeated contact with hard materials. When the tool is chosen properly, it enhances tool life, minimises rework and gives a cleaner surface finish. For beginners, the large range of CNC tooling may seem complex, but the basic goal is simple: select the correct tool for the specific job requirement.

Milling Cutters for Accurate Material Removal


Milling cutters are widely used tools in CNC machining. They are engineered to cut material from a workpiece by high-speed rotation while the machine manages movement along different axes. Milling cutters are used for face milling, shoulder milling, slotting, contouring and profile machining. The right cutter helps achieve better chip control, smoother cutting action and improved surface quality. For workshops handling different materials, cutter selection should focus on diameter, number of flutes, insert compatibility, cutting depth and machine power. A properly selected milling cutter can minimise vibration and enhance stability during heavy machining tasks.

Endmills for Versatile Machining Operations


Endmills are multi-purpose tools used for various machining tasks. They are available in different flute designs, coatings and geometries for various materials such as steel, stainless steel, aluminium, cast iron and non-ferrous metals. Solid carbide endmills are popular because they provide durability and performance. Beginners should know that one endmill cannot perform every job equally well. A roughing endmill may be ideal for bulk cutting, while a fine cutting endmill is better for smooth final surfaces. Choosing the correct endmill helps ensure precision and safeguard both the tool and machine spindle.

Tool Holders for Stability and Accuracy


Tool holders are essential because they secure the cutting tool during machining. Even the highest quality tool may fail to perform well if the holding system is unstable or incorrectly selected. A good tool holder minimises vibration, enhances accuracy and keeps the tool aligned during cutting. This results in improved finish, longer tool life and precise results. Carbide Drills for Strong Drilling Performance


Carbide Drills are widely used when high accuracy and durability are required. Compared with basic drilling tools, carbide drills provide better hardness, heat resistance and cutting performance. They are ideal for precision drilling in different industrial materials. Proper drill selection depends on key drilling parameters. When used correctly, carbide drills can produce smooth hole walls, precise placement and faster production. They are highly effective for workshops that need repeatable drilling results in mass production.

Threadmilling Cutters for Precision Threading


Threadmilling cutters are used to create thread forms with high control and consistency. Unlike tapping, thread milling allows better chip evacuation and is ideal for challenging materials or larger thread sizes. It also offers more flexibility because one tool can often be used for different thread diameters. Thread milling is beneficial when thread quality, tool safety and process control are important. For new users, it may require more programming knowledge than basic drilling or tapping, but the advantages can be significant in accurate machining.

U Drills for Productive Hole Making


U Drills are replaceable-insert drills designed for efficient hole making. They use changeable cutting tips, which means the entire drill does not need to be replaced when the cutting edge wears out. This makes them economical for continuous drilling. U drills are useful for larger holes, high-speed drilling and production environments where downtime must be reduced. Their design ensures stable cutting and quick maintenance. For workshops looking to improve drilling productivity, U drills can be a valuable tool.

The Role of Milling Inserts in Cost Control


Milling inserts are indexable inserts mounted on cutter bodies. They allow workshops to continue using the same cutter body while replacing only the worn insert. This helps reduce tooling cost and enhances productivity. Inserts are offered in different grades, coatings and geometries for specific materials and cutting conditions. Carbide inserts are widely used because they offer durability. Choosing the correct insert shape and grade helps improve chip flow, reduce cutting pressure and deliver smoother surfaces.
